| Mission Statement | The Mission of Sherman College of Chiropractic: To be the leader in bringing straight chiropractic to the world. Our mission is based upon the college's philosophy and core values, and encompasses: Chiropractic Education: We shall educate, graduate, and support competent, compassionate, ethical and successful doctors of chiropractic who excel as primary health care providers centered on vertebral subluxation. Chiropractic Research: We shall support and produce research and scholarly activities that contribute to the body of knowledge on chiropractic education, clinical knowledge, health care and the theoretical constructs of vertebral subluxation. Chiropractic Service: We shall serve humanity by providing the highest quality in chiropractic care, public education, professional partnerships and community initiatives. |
